as posted by the channelJudges on the 9th Circuit Court of Appeals expressed skepticism toward Trump's lawsuit over being banned from Twitter two years ago. While Team Trump argued that the ban curbed his First Amendment rights, the judges on the three-judge panel argued that Twitter was not threatened byt the government and made the decision as its own. Because it's a non-government entity, it was within its boundaries in banning Trump.
